How to Make Date and Cashew Energy Balls

Making these tasty date and cashew energy balls is a breeze. They’re great for anyone looking for a quick, healthy snack. You can make them in your kitchen with ease.

You don’t need much to make these energy balls. A food processor or blender is all you need. It makes the process simple and fun.

Step-by-Step Preparation Instructions

  1. Gather all ingredients: raw cashews, pitted dates, gluten-free oats, and additional mix-ins
  2. Process raw cashews in the blender for approximately 5 minutes until finely ground
  3. Add pitted dates,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and a pinch of salt
  4. Blend ingredients until a sticky, cohesive mixture forms
  5. Incorporate dried cranberries and shredded coconut
  6. Roll mixture into small balls (approximately 1 1/2 tablespoons per ball)
  7. Chill energy balls for recommended 2 hours or overnight

Helpful Preparation Tips

Here are some tips to help you make these snacks:

  • Use soft Medjool dates that split easily by hand
  • If dates are dried, soak them in hot water for 10 minutes before processing
  • Ensure mixture is sticky enough to hold together when rolled
  • Experiment with different mix-ins for variety

Storing Date and Cashew Energy Balls

Energy Bites Storage Methods

Keeping your homemade snacks fresh is key to enjoying delicious energy bites throughout the week. Proper storage ensures your nutritious treats maintain their incredible flavor and texture.

Best Practices for Freshness

Your date and cashew energy balls can stay fresh with the right storage techniques. Here are some top recommendations:

  • Store in an airtight container
  • Keep refrigerated at 40°F or below
  • Place par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king
  • Consume within 1 week for optimal taste

Freezing Tips

Freezing is an excellent way to extend the life of your energy bites. Follow these simple guidelines:

  1. Place energy bites on a baking sheet
  2. Freeze for 45 minutes until solid
  3. Transfer to a freezer-safe container
  4. Store up to 3 months

FAQ

How long can I store homemade date and cashew energy balls?

Store them in an airtight container in the fridge for 7-10 days. Freeze for up to 3 months for longer storage. They’ll stay fresh and tasty.

Are these energy balls suitable for people with dietary restrictions?

Yes, they fit many diets. They’re gluten-free and can be vegan with plant-based ingredients. For nut allergies, use sunflower or pumpkin seeds instead of cashews.

Can I make these energy balls without a food processor?

A food processor helps, but you can also use a blender or chop ingredients by hand. It takes more effort but still yields tasty energy balls.

How many energy balls should I eat in a day?

Eat 1-2 for a snack, about 100-200 calories. It depends on your diet and activity level. They’re great for a quick energy boost.

Are these energy balls good for pre-workout nutrition?

Yes! They’re perfect for pre-workout. Dates give quick energy, and nuts provide sustained energy. They’re great for fueling workouts.

Can children eat these energy balls?

Yes, they’re a healthy snack for kids. They’re natural and full of nutrients. Just watch for nut allergies and supervise young kids.

What are some popular flavor variations?

Try adding cocoa powder, coconut flakes, chia seeds, dried berries, or protein powder. Favorites include chocolate-cherry, coconut-lime, and pumpkin spice.

How do I achieve the right consistency when making energy balls?

Aim for a sticky but not wet mix. Add water or sweetener if too dry. More nuts or dried fruits help if too wet.
